princewood

from WordNet (r) 3.0 (2006)
princewood
    n 1: tropical American timber tree [syn: {princewood}, {Spanish
         elm}, {Cordia gerascanthus}]
    2: large tropical American tree of the genus Cordia grown for
       its abundant creamy white flowers and valuable wood [syn:
       {Spanish elm}, {Equador laurel}, {salmwood}, {cypre},
       {princewood}, {Cordia alliodora}]
    
from The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.48
Princewood \Prince"wood`\, n. (Bot.)
   The wood of two small tropical American trees ({Hamelia
   ventricosa}, and {Cordia gerascanthoides}). It is brownish,
   veined with lighter color.
